St. George Illawarra Dragons

An aviary

I would say a bird cage, but Jack Bird will need more freedom than that if he's to return to his damaging best next year. He's been hardly sighted on-field since departing Cronulla due to successive shoulder and knee reconstructions, but a return to his junior club and a move to lock will have Jack raring to go. He's not a peacock, but you got to let him fly.
